2014 Nissan cube and 2017 Chevrolet SS Specifications

Model Year 2014 2017  
Model Nissan cube Chevrolet SS  
Engine  
Transmission  
Drivetrain  
Body 4dr Hatch 4dr Sedan  
      Difference
Wheelbase 99.6 in 114.8 in -15.2 in
Length 156.5 in 195.5 in -39 in
Width 66.7 in 74.7 in -8 in
Height 65.0 in 57.9 in 7.1 in
Curb Weight 2762 lb. 3997 lb. -1235 lb.
Fuel Capacity 13.2 gal. 18.8 gal. -5.6 gal.
Headroom, Row 1 42.6 in 38.7 in 3.9 in
Shoulder Room, Row 1 52.2 in 59.1 in -6.9 in
Hip Room, Row 1 48.8 in 57.2 in -8.4 in
Legroom, Row 1 42.4 in 42.3 in 0.1 in
Headroom, Row 2 40.2 in 38.0 in 2.2 in
Shoulder Room, Row 2 52.4 in 59.0 in -6.6 in
Hip Room, Row 2 47.6 in 58.0 in -10.4 in
Legroom, Row 2 35.5 in 39.7 in -4.2 in
Total Legroom 77.9 in (over 2 rows) 82 in (over 2 rows) -4.1 in
Cargo Volume, Minimum 11.4 ft3 16.4 ft3 -5 ft3
Cargo Volume, Maximum 58.1 ft3 16.4 ft3 41.7 ft3

What Our Members Are Saying about the Seat Room and Comfort of the 2017 Chevrolet SS

2017 Chevrolet SS Seat Room and Comfort: Pros
YearBody/PowertrainComment
2017 4dr Sedan 415-horsepower 6.2L V8
6-speed manual RWD
Rear seat is functional and roomy. I'm 6'4" and with the drivers seat in my preferred postion there is still a decent amount of legroom behind. Overall much better than the Charger/Challenger. see full Chevrolet SS review
2017 Chevrolet SS Seat Room and Comfort: Cons
YearBody/PowertrainComment
2017 4dr Sedan 415-horsepower 6.2L V8
6-speed manual RWD
The front seat is just OK. Feels like a pretty flat bottom and fairly hard. Also, for a car with sporting pretentions there is surprisingly little side bolstering. see full Chevrolet SS review
